Otsi.ee Company Presentation Keith Siilats

Otsi.ee is a meta-engine Bridging paper media and Internet by making searches in newspaper archives fee based Making net versions of newspapers profitable Providing a database of internet users (bank details, credit cards) Additional activities based on the database (auctions, internet shops) Real-time translations allowing English language queries

Key investment attractions Rapidly growing sector Monopoly market segment Strong links to existing media for free (xxl.ee, all newspapers) Very little actual competition and first mover advantage Experienced creators Very little initial investment

Estonia and its internet market –The structure of the internet business market Rapidly growing (100%+) Aim: to turn technical expertise into simple usage Highly competitive –Factors affecting the development of the IT sector Economic growth (rapid in Estonia) Education level (extremely high) Computer penetration (comparable to western levels) Cost of use (rapidly falling)

Current Estonian users Target group - people who use internet for work and students who use internet more than once a week growing 60% a year (oct 98 BMF) 53% read online newspapers 2% use internet shops 42% have an internet bank account 8000 people have paid for goods in the net, but have registered to an online site 59% read more newspapers than an average Estonian 2000 read epl.ee daily, 850 search information 7000 and 3000 for Postimees.ee Otsi.ee beta attracts ~5 new registered users a day without any advertising

Competitive Analysis Competitors Newspapers themselves and Strengths Newspapers - existing copyrights, extensive finance - Existing market share Weaknesses Newspapers - no flexibility, expertise and willingness - no connections to newspapers, not a comprehensive archive, no registration modules

Technology Description –SQL databases with Glimpse indexing, Perl scripts generating HTML front-end –English online translation service from ibs.ee Strategy –simultaneous searching of all newspapers and charging (1 month) –Reaching more than 500 searches a day and users (1 year) –Development of additional services and selling of the database (1 year)

Pricing and marketing policy Search is free, viewing of the actual article costs money 70% of the revenues from articles goes to newspapers, 20% of the other services (preliminary contracts) Charging –Internet bank accounts, bills by , 900 phone numbers, extra fee for paper bills –Per article and per month plans

Description of the business Legal structure - AS Technocholics representing a Delaware company. No tax obligations for internet usage. Operational Structure - Management, Marketing (zero.ee) and Technology (javalogics.com) Estdata provides internet connection and receives 10% of profits Customers Professional researchers and companies Media monitoring Students Occasional interested parties and foreigners

Sales and Marketing Direct marketing from newspapers websites (the search box at epl.ee redirects to otsi.ee) Free ads in newspapers (they get 70% of revenue) Search engine registration Media hype for new product Banner exchange with yahoo Referral program (10% for referred customers)

Financial Projections –5 EEK a search, 50 EEK for translated documents –50 EEK a month for individual subscription –Multiple subscriptions from companies –500 searches for 22 days with half being from subscribers ( searches a month) –1000 subscribers –Total Cash flow EEK –80% away to newspapers and Estdata –50% revenue from extra services –Total revenue (0.2x x100)x12 months = 1 milj EEK –Maintenance programmer costs EEK a year
